Linden Park Apartments in Bolton Hill is a smoke-free community for seniors 62 and older in the historic Bolton Hill area of Baltimore.
Enjoy convenient shopping and public transportation, as well as many onsite amenities - life alert, a wellness suite, Zip Cars, laundry center, professional management and services coordinator, 24 hour emergency maintenance, as well as the Eating Together program. Since this property has a Project-Based Section 8 contract with HUD, some or all of the rents at this community are based on tenant incomes. Tenants leasing units participating in the Section 8 Project-Based Rental Assistance program typically contribute less than 30% of their adjusted income towards rental costs.
Since this property was built or renovated using funding from HUD's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ly program, residency is usually restricted to households earning 50% of the Area Median Income (AMI) or less with at least one member age 62 years or older. Tenants pay rent based on household income. This rent is usually the highest of the following three amounts: either 30% adjusted monthly income, or 10% unadjusted monthly income, or, if receiving welfare assistance, the housing costs portion of this assistance.
